Supporting vulnerable residents

Posted on the 6th April 2020

We know that many people are struggling with the impact of the COVID-19 pandemic. We have already written to residents to reassure you that you will not lose your home if you suffer a loss of income during this crisis.

The safety of our residents is a top priority for us. We have identified some of our residents who may be more vulnerable, for many reasons, such as age or health conditions and are calling them to see how they are doing. We have staff calling customers to find out if they have the basics such as food, fuel and medicine and also whether they are struggling financially.

Once any difficulties have been identified, referrals will be made to the relevant Paradigm team to offer help and support.

We will be making these calls over the next few weeks to as many people as possible, prioritising those with the highest needs, but if you would like to talk to us more urgently contact our Customer Service team on 0300 303 1010.
